What is hex #517F86 Color?

Wintergreen Dream (Hex code: 517F86)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#517F86 is Wintergreen Dream. The RGB values are (81, 127, 134) which means it is composed of 24% red, 37% green and 39%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:40 M:5 Y:0 K:48. In the HSV/HSB scale, #517F86 has a hue of 188°, 40% saturation and a brightness value of 53%.

Hex #517F86 Color Palettes

Complementary color palette of 517F86. Complementary color is 865851

Complementary Palette

The complement of #517F86 is #865851 which is called Spicy Mix.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#517F86 color is offered by #865851.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Analogous color palette with (517F86, 516586 and 518673)

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#517F86 are #516586 and #518673, called Dark Electric Blue and Wintergreen Dream, resp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#517F86 with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split Complementary color palette with (517F86, 865165 and 867351)

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#517F86 are #865165 (Twilight Lavender) and #867351 (Gold Fusion).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ic color palette with (517F86, 86517F and 7F8651)

Triadic Palette

#517F86 tri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#86517F (Razzmic Berry) and #7F8651 (Gold Fusion) along with #517F86,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.

Tetradic color palette with (517F86, 86517F, 865851 and 518658)

Tetradic Palette

The tetradic palette of #517F86 has #86517F (Razzmic Berry), #865851 (Spicy Mix) and #518658 (Middle Green). A tetradic color palette is complex and, in most cases, should not be used off-the-shelf. We suggest tweaking the colors a little bit to achieve desired results.

Square color palette with (517F86, 735186, 865851 and 658651)

Square Palette

The square color palette of #517F86 contains #735186 (Dark Lavender), #865851 (Spicy Mix) and #658651 (Axolotl).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
